- Nymand WaltonAug 20, 2025 · 10 months agoYes, the Trezor hardware wallet is designed to support multiple c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in. It offers a secure and convenient way to store and manage your digital assets. However, it's important to note that the availability of specific cryptocurrencies may vary depending on the firmware version and updates provided by Trezor.
